1.
使用StringUtils进行防御性编程
PolicyTypeEnum.isB2B方法
B2B_POLICY_ONE_WAY.getPolicyType().equals(policyType);
替换为
StringUtils.equals(B2B_POLICY_ONE_WAY.getPolicyType(), policyType)
2.
使用joda-time替代SimpleDateFormat和synchronized
比如CommonUtils
1.
PolicyTypeEnum.isB2B方法
B2B_POLICY_ONE_WAY.getPolicyType().equals(policyType);
替换为
StringUtils.equals(B2B_POLICY_ONE_WAY.getPolicyType(), policyType)
2.
比如CommonUtils